Michael Fischer
Biography
Michael is a founding partner of Fischer Ramp Partner AG. He advises private clients on their domestic and international estate, tax and succession planning as well as on philanthropic projects and governance related questions. He acts on behalf of corporations, in particular family held companies and family offices, in domestic and cross-border matters. His practice also includes contentious matters before Swiss tax authorities and courts. Michael is a frequent speaker at national and international conferences and a regular contributor to tax journals and publications. He lectures international tax law at EXPERTsuisse where he heads the module International Tax and he is a regular guest lecturer at University of St. Gallen (HSG). He holds law degrees from the University of Zurich (lic. iur., 1999) and the London School of Economics (LL.M., 2003). He was admitted to the Zurich Bar in 2002 and qualified as a certified tax expert in 2010. Prior to co-founding Fischer Ramp Partner AG Michael spent 13 years as associate and partner in an international Swiss law firm in London (2003 to 2006) and in Zurich (from 2006). Chambers Europe, Chambers Global, now Chambers HNW (Band2), Legal 500, Who’s Who Legal and BestLawyers continuously rank him as a leader in the fields of Private Client and Tax. Since 2017 Michael has been listed in the Private Client Global Elite. Michael is a member of the Zurich Bar Association and the Swiss Bar Association. He is on the Steering Committee of the International Tax Specialist Group (ITSG), and he sits on the Committee of the Swiss arm of Philanthropy Impact. His working languages are German, English and French.
